Repeater controller has gone on the "critical list" as was noted about a
month ago when there was a "brown" out in the Plymouth area. The voltage
"swing" was too fast for auxiliary power switch over, yet long enough to
cause problems with controller commands. Many of the DTMF commands did not
work and a trip to the repeater site was needed to return 147.06 to "normal"
operation. The controller is over 25 years old has survived several site
moves and many "near" lightening strikes. An appeal has been made for
donations to go specifically toward the controller fund. Remember that
donations to the SCARC are tax deductible, and consider just how much each
of us use the machine, it would be a shame to have it off the air for an
extended amount of time.
